class
astroplan.
AtNightConstraint
(max_solar_altitude=<Quantity 0.0 deg>, force_pressure_zero=True)[source]¶ Bases:
astroplan.Constraint
Constrain the Sun to be below
horizon
.Parameters: max_solar_altitude :
Quantity
The altitude of the sun below which it is considered to be “night” (inclusive).
force_pressure_zero : bool (optional)
Force the pressure to zero for solar altitude calculations. This avoids errors in the altitude of the Sun that can occur when the Sun is below the horizon and the corrections for atmospheric refraction return nonsense values.
